1. IRobot Roomba S9+

The iRobot Roomba S9+ is one of the most highly-rated robot vacuums. It has a lot of features and impressive cleaning power, such as a dirt compartment that is integrated into the base of charging. This robot can recognize your habits for cleaning and recommend automatic schedules that will give you the ultimate hands-free cleaning experience.

The iRobot Home App guides you through the process of setting up. Once the system is in place, you can start automated cleaning with a single button. You can select an overall clean that focuses on the removal of large debris such as rice and cereal, or opt for two thorough maps of your space to ensure that your entire home is properly arranged.

This robot vacuum performs well both on bare floors and carpets with a low pile. It can pick up pet hair and clean big objects up. It doesn't lose suction as fast as some other robot vacuums. It has a difficult time with plush or high-pile carpets however, iRobot promises that the next models will be more efficient.

The S9+ is a new design from iRobot that focuses on enhancing the edge and corner cleaning. It's the very first Roomba that has an open-fronted, flat-fronted design. The company hopes this will allow it hug furniture and walls. It's a significant improvement over hockey puck-shaped robovacs which are widely used, but we found it only marginally superior to circular models.

iRobot also claims the S9+ has an improved filter system that prevents tiny dust particles and allergens from circulating within your home. It's a nice claim, but we're not convinced it's enough to justify the price price.

Its smart navigation system employs a combination of sensors to keep track of your home's layout, and vSLAM technology for mapping the interior. It then cleans your entire house efficiently by avoiding obstacles like stairs and other obstacles. The iRobot Home app lets you control the robot and set cleaning times, and set up virtual boundaries, so it can recognize areas that need extra attention.

2. Roborock Q Revo

Roborock Q Revo is a robotic that combines mopping and vacuuming. Its vacuum settings are just as effective as those found on higher-end models. Its mopping system is superior as its spinning pads scrub floors better than a vibrating pad.

The only issue is the lack of a second brush for deeper cleaning. But that's not a problem if you want to own one of the top robots available. The robo-vac's tank for dust is larger than many of its competitors and it takes only two or three cycles to fill it up, even at the highest dirt level.

In terms of the mopping system, I was amazed by its ability to scrub tough dirt off my floors. The two lowest mopping settings which are less powerful than high-powered modes, produce very little noise, so you can work or watch television without being distracted. It will gently bump into a wall or furniture and then move on if it comes across one.

What distinguishes the Q Revo apart is that it's designed to run nearly autonomously with very little need for user intervention. The robo-vac features a multi-function dock that can automatically transfer physical trash to the bin hidden from view, as well as washes and dry the mop pads, and refills its clean water tank. The app is good at alerting you when something is in need of attention, like the clean water tank running low or a scheduled cleaning session that was cancelled due to a full dust bin.

You can also create and merge rooms to modify how the Q Revo manages your home. This is a great feature for those who have multiple areas of the home with different floor materials or if there's some clutter that needs to be cleared out frequently, like toys, clothes, and books. The robot vacuum was also among the top performers in my test and was able to remove debris from both carpets as well as hardwood floors on the first go. It can even remove wet spills but I would suggest drying them using a clean cloth before bringing the robot into.

3. Ecovacs Deebot X2 Omni

The X2 Omni has all of the features you'd want from a top-quality robot vacuum and mop combo and more. It has an omni-rotating mop as well as a powerful vacuum that can clean carpets as well as hard floors. It's similar to the iRobot Roomba S9+. It also comes with a self-cleaning station that automatically cleans and empty the mop pads, keeping them fresh and ready for reuse. It also has a new sensor system that is able to better detects obstacles, giving it the ability to prevent falling over furniture and other objects.

The biggest improvement over the ECOVACS Deebot X1 is that this version is sleeker and more modern design, thanks to Danish firm Jacob Jensen Design (best robot mop for wood floors known for Bang & Olufsen products). While still quite big--it's over two feet in height and depth and weighs nearly four pounds--the robot and its base are smaller than the Roborock Q Revo or iRobot J7.

This version is also more efficient than the X1 version, since it has a faster charging speed for batteries and can handle a full cleaning of around 1,500 square feet with just one charge. It also has a larger and more robust dust bin that can hold more debris. This makes it easier to empty.

Finally lastly, the X2 Omni has a more intuitive app as well as voice assistant that operates offline, so you can use it even if you're not at home. It also comes with more mopping modes and a smart routing feature that gives it the flexibility to clean certain rooms or areas of your home instead of simply following a predetermined route.

The X2 Omni has the best robotic mop and vacuum mopping performance of any robot we've tested, due to its mop pads rotating to clean tough stains away and a motor that generates plenty of downward pressure. Its vacuuming performance is top-notch, and it boosts suction when it senses carpets to ensure thorough cleaning. It is equipped with a large, rechargeable battery that lasts up to seven days. The mopping mode of the robot is also powerful.

4. Dreametech L10s Ultra

The Dreametech L10s Ultra robot mop and vacuum is a top-quality model that offers a number of features that aren't typically found on robots in this price range. It has the ability to create detailed floor maps, detect various flooring types and is among the few robots that automatically wash and dry its mop pads. These features are great, but they also make the L10s more of a class of luxury. This could mean it's more expensive than what homeowners want.

The L10s Ultra looks like a modern floor cleaner. It is slim and tall and has a white-colored finish accented with silver elements and mirror plating. The front of the machine is dominated by a huge bumper, which protects furniture and the vacuum from damage when moving around the house. Behind the pane at the front is additional navigation technology that is comprised of sensors that help the L10s Ultra maneuver tight corners and avoid obstacles.

On the top of the vacuum there is a single button that serves as an on/off switch. This button will activate the vacuum. Clicking it again will turn it off and transmit it back to its base station. The central control panel is the circular menu which lets you select cleaning modes, schedules, and best robot vacuum And mop preferences. The left and right buttons beneath the screen will open the settings menu in which you can alter the way that the L10s Ultra works with your home.

The L10s Ultra, like the iRobot Roomba S9+ or Roborock Q Revo uses a combination LIDAR and cameras-based navigation technology to map your home. This allows the robot to clean and mop efficiently, without getting stuck. The LIDAR helps the robot vacuum avoid obstacles and identify them, which is an excellent feature for households with pets or young children.

The L10s Ultra offers solid vacuuming performance, clearing 98.4 percent of debris from our hard-floor test and getting rid of all but the most stubborn juice stains. The mops are also efficient, taking away 98.4 percent of the debris that was found on our tile, wood, and carpet tests. It was not as effective in removing sand from the hard floor or quaker oatmeal from the carpet.
